Abstract

A system and method for reducing execution errors make by a software service are disclosed. The service has several features whose execution paths are switched on or off by corresponding feature toggles, i.e. flags in a configuration database. The performance, and especially error generation, of each feature is monitored automatically and an instantaneous error rate is produced. When the error rate exceeds a given threshold error rate for a particular feature, the corresponding toggle is disabled in the configuration database and the service is triggered to restart using the updated toggles, thereby disabling the problematic feature. The system and method also determine whether the error rate increased due to a transient error condition, such as a data link drop or a secondary service restart, and re-enable the toggle when the error condition has passed.
